ML6 Polyurethane for Semiconductor Manufacturing

Meridian Laboratory's ML6 polyurethane components are used throughout semiconductor manufacturing, including wafer handling systems, scribe dicing, and rotating rail assemblies. Each part is precision-molded to exact dimensions with extremely tight tolerances for consistent, flat, and repeatable contact. ML6 polyurethane molded components retain their outer “skin”, preventing particle flaking or material tear-off, unlike ground parts. With no grinding and extraordinary bond strength, ML6 parts reduce contamination risk and maintain integrity under continuous use.

Common Applications & Uses for Molded Polyurethane in the Semiconductor Industry

Non-Contaminating & Precision Molded

ML6 molded polyurethane is used in precision vacuum chucks for the handling and moving of silicon wafers during their production.

The ML6 Advantage

ML6 polyurethane is molded to exact dimensions with an intact outer surface that prevents flaking or chipping that could contaminate clean environments. Precise flatness ensures even and consistent contact for wafer handling.

TIGHT TOLERANCES & PARTICLE-FREE PERFORMANCE

ML6 molded rollers and grippers are used in scribe dicing equipment to precisely cleave LEDs, laser diodes, transistors, and more.

The ML6 Advantage

ML6 polyurethane is precision molded for extremely consistent performance and without risk of tear-off or material flaking, maintaining material integrity during high-precision dicing operations.

Zero Contamination & Metal-Free Contact

ML6 polyurethane covered cam followers and yoke rollers are used in fuse and chip manufacturing operations for rotating rail assemblies.

The ML6 Advantage

ML6 polyurethane is made without grinding to eliminate contamination, for clean and debris-free production.
